Can you provide a screenshot and some more details? Note those settings determine the highest LOD to request. As you look off into the distance, you will see progressively lower levels of detail in the texture. The LOD radius determines the number of tiles you should see at a given LOD before dropping to the next LOD. It's also not an exact measurement because the size of a terrain tile gets smaller as you get closer to the poles.
